Description This listing features a genuine fossil snake vertebra from the extinct marine snake species Palaeophis maghrebians, discovered in Eocene deposits of Morocco. This intriguing specimen represents a member of one of the largest snake genera known from the Paleogene, with marine adaptations akin to those of modern sea snakes. Fossil Type & Species: Type: Vertebra (Axial skeleton) Genus: Palaeophis Species: maghrebians A marine-adapted snake with vertebrae optimized for lateral undulatory swimming in aquatic environments Geological Context: Era: Cenozoic Period: Paleogene Epoch: Eocene (~56 to 33.9 million years ago) Depositional Environment: Shallow marine and coastal settings indicating warm tropical conditions conducive to reptilian gigantism Morphological Features: Elongated, laterally compressed vertebra with a high neural spine Well-preserved centrum and articulation facets Indicative of a powerful, sinuous swimming motion used by aquatic snakes Scientific Importance: Palaeophis is part of the extinct family Palaeophiidae, known for some of the earliest fully aquatic snakes These fossils help trace the evolutionary history and ecological diversity of early marine reptiles Taxonomic Classification: Order: Squamata Superfamily: Palaeophioidea Family: Palaeophiidae Locality Information: Morocco – Eocene marine sediments rich in vertebrate fossils, including early whales, rays, and reptiles like Palaeophis Authenticity & Display: All of our fossils are 100% Genuine Specimens and come with a Certificate of Authenticity.
